What is De-normalization?

Asked 20-Nov-2017
Viewed 733 times

1 Answer


0

De-normalization is an important concept in database design, which is used to improve performance and reduce complexity. It is the process of reorganizing data in a database to reduce redundancy and improve the performance of certain queries.

Simply put, de-normalization is a way of organizing data in a database to reduce the amount of data redundancy and improve the performance of certain queries. It involves the elimination of redundant data and incorporating the non-redundant data into larger, more complex data structures.

Normalization is the process of organizing data into a logical structure that minimizes redundant data. The process of normalization includes the analysis of relationships between data items, the identification of appropriate key fields, and the identification of relationships between tables. It is a process that reduces the size and complexity of a database.

De-normalization is the opposite of normalization. It is the process of reorganizing data in a database in order to reduce redundancy and improve the performance of certain queries. It involves the addition of redundant data and the incorporation of large and complex data structures.

De-normalization can be divided into two categories: logical de-normalization and physical de-normalization. Logical de-normalization involves the addition of redundant data and the incorporation of large and complex data structures. Physical de-normalization involves the addition of redundant data and the reorganization of the physical layout of the database.

De-normalization is often used in databases with large amounts of data. In such cases, the data can be organized in a more efficient manner to reduce the amount of redundant data and improve the performance of certain queries.

By de-normalizing the data, you can add redundant data to the database and make it easier to query the data. You can also reorganize the physical layout of the database in order to reduce redundancy and improve the performance of certain queries. De-normalization can significantly improve the performance of certain queries by reducing the amount of data redundancy and improving the speed of certain queries.

De-normalization is an important concept in database design and is often used to improve the performance of certain queries. It involves the elimination of redundant data and the incorporation of large and complex data structures. By de-normalizing the data, you can reduce the amount of redundant data and improve the performance of certain queries.